
Activision released a new trailer of Raven’s Wolfenstein this morning, and pretty damn sensational it looked too. One thing, though: there’s no PC or Games for Windows logo listed in the game’s platforms at the end.
Eagle-eyed VG247 reader ShiroGamer spotted the omission, and it’s certainly true. Only 360 and PS3 are listed in the movie’s splash screen, as you can see in the image above.
The shooter was announced for “Xbox 360, PS3, Windows PC” just before E3 last year.
Has the PC version been dropped? Or did Mr Video-Maker do a booboo?
